Product: L-fuculose phosphate aldolase
Products: NA
Alternate protein names: L-fuculose-1-phosphate aldolase [H]

Specific function: Catalyzes the reversible aldol cleavage of L-fuculose-1- phosphate to dihydroxyacetone phosphate (DHAP) and L-lactaldehyde. The substrate preference order is glyceraldehyde > DL- lactaldehyde, glycolaldehyde > acrolein > formaldehyde, methylglyoxal > acet
COG id: COG0235
COG function: function code G; Ribulose-5-phosphate 4-epimerase and related epimerases and aldolases
